Ingredients
- 3 cups seedless watermelon, cubed
- 1/3 cup cucumber, thinly sliced
- 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 4–5 tablespoons fresh mint, chopped or torn
- 3 thin slices red onion (optional)
- 2 teaspoons extra virgin olive oil
- Fresh lime juice, to taste
- Salt & pepper, to taste
- Light drizzle of balsamic glaze
Refreshing Summer Watermelon Salad Instructions
In a large bowl, combine the watermelon, cucumber, mint, and red onion.

Squeeze fresh lime juice over the mixture and gently toss to combine.

Sprinkle feta cheese over the top.

Drizzle with olive oil and a light balsamic glaze.

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ve immediately or chilled.
Storage Tips
This watermelon salad is best served fresh, but you can store it in an airtight container in the fridge for one day. Otherwise, the ingredients will become too soggy.
Refreshing Summer Watermelon Salad Tips
- Pat the watermelon dry to reduce excess moisture, which helps preserve the salad’s crispness.
- Use English or Persian cucumbers, as they are crisper and less watery.
- Cube the watermelon evenly to ensure consistent flavor and texture in every bite.
